Support the Arts at CIIS

With 12-15 annual art exhibitions, artist lectures, and interdisciplinary conversations, The Arts at CIIS promotes dialogue across disciplines, and within and between communities, about the arts, visual culture, and social change. The Arts at CIIS relies on the generosity of its donors to fulfill its mission of celebrating creativity, community engagement, and integrative approaches to the social questions facing contemporary society through art. Friends of the Arts
Friends of the Arts at CIIS brings together community members who are dedicated to supporting and promoting The Arts at CIIS. Friends of the Arts are invited to private walkthroughs of each Arts at CIIS exhibition, as well as invited to quarterly salons held at private homes where guests and exhibiting artists gather to discuss art in an intimate setting.
